Production Report, Weighted Average

Manzer Inc. manufactures bicycle frames in two departments: cutting and welding. Manzer uses the weighted-average method. Manufacturing costs are added uniformly throughout the process. The following are cost and production data for the cutting department for October:

Production:  
Units in process, October 1, 40% complete 4,000
Units completed and transferred out 27,200
Units in process, October 31, 60% complete 8,000
Costs:  
WIP, October 1 $ 32,000
Costs added during October 608,000

Prepare a production report for the cutting department. Round cost per equivalent unit to the nearest cent. Use this rounded amount for further calculations. If an amount box does not require an entry, leave it blank or enter "0"
